Eve Rehn: Traveler IQ Fanatic
Eve Rehn, Traveler IQ addict
|
People worldwide are playing Traveler IQ, TravelPod's addictive geography game more than 4 million times per month. Eve Rehn, 48, is the most prolific player of the game. She has been playing it daily for about two months. So far, she has logged more than 9,000 games. "I'm a very extreme person," Rehn says, "it's all or nothing." Click here to find out all about Eve
Boston Blogger Meet Up
Kevin, Josh and Shaun
|
When I found out the TravelPod whole team was going to Boston for a conference, I decided to host an informal, drop-in meetup for some Massachusetts bloggers. So Shaun McQuaker, one of our web developers and I went down to the Espresso Royale on Newbury St. to meet Josh Bloomer, a rockstar, big fan of India and motorcycle aficionado and Kevin Eldridge, a European backpacker and exchange student. It was really cool to meet people who are as psyched about traveling as I am. We talked about where we've been, where we plan on going, over some delicious chai tea.
